Rule 120-2-2-.16 - Time Computation

Current through Rules and Regulations filed through March 20, 2024

1. In computing any time period prescribed in these rules, the day from which the designated period begins to run is not included. The last day of the period so computed is included, unless it is a Saturday, Sunday, or state holiday. Intermediate Saturdays, Sundays, and state holidays are included in the computation.

2. When a party may or must act within a specified time after being served and service is made under Rule 120-2-2-.14(1)(c)(ii)(3) (mail), (4) (leaving it with the Department), or (5) (other means consented to), three days are added after the period would otherwise expire under Rule 120-2-2-.16(1).
